Nurse Practitioners Salary in Arizona

BLS Occupational Employment & Wage Statistics • May 2025 • Arizona nonmetropolitan area

Median annual salary $131,400 +1.7% vs national
Median hourly $63.17
10th percentile $100,350
90th percentile $186,650
Employed locally 160
National median $129,210

    Frequently asked questions

    How much do Nurse Practitioners make per hour in Arizona?

    The median hourly wage for Nurse Practitioners in Arizona is $63.17, based on BLS OEWS 2025 data. Top earners (90th percentile) make $87.00 or more per hour.

    Is Arizona above or below average for Nurse Practitioners salaries?

    The median Nurse Practitioners salary in Arizona is 1.7% above the national median of $129,210. The national figure is from BLS OEWS 2025 data covering all US metropolitan areas.

    What is the entry-level salary for Nurse Practitioners in Arizona?

    Entry-level Nurse Practitioners (10th percentile) earn around $100,350 per year in Arizona. The 25th percentile — typically workers with 1–3 years of experience — earn approximately $127,790.
